ConfigNodePatchUpgradeSectionRulesfieldRules Field | 
 
            Defines the rules to apply to the node's fields if the 
action is
            
Fix.

Remarks
            The value is comma separated pairs of "
name=value". The "name" designates the field
            name within the persisted module state, and "value" specifies a new value. Field name can
            have a special prefix symbol that defines a special case or how the new value should be
            applied:
            
- No prefix. Tells to add a new value. The existing value(s) in the persisted state
            will not be affected. This can be used to add multiple values to a key.
            
 - 
            "-". Tells to erase the value(s) or node(s) at the key. There are no checks done
            to verify if there is something to delete.
            
 - 
            "%". Tells to assign a new value to an existing filed or create a new value if none
            exists.
            
 
            The rules are applied in the order they are listed in the patch. It's important to
            consider it when applying multiple rules to the same key.
